Proper Installation Techniques for Optimal Drainage

Proper Installation Techniques are paramount for ensuring optimal drainage in permeable walking paths. This involves careful preparation of the subbase, utilizing appropriate materials like gravel and sand, and adhering to specific grading requirements to ensure water flows smoothly through the paving system. A key advantage of permeable driveway installation is its capacity to manage stormwater naturally, reducing the risk of flooding and erosion.
During the installation process, best practices for permeable paver systems should be followed. This includes ensuring proper compaction of the subbase, correct placement of the pavers, and sealing any gaps with a suitable jointing material. These steps are crucial not only for maintaining the structural integrity of the path but also for preserving its drainage capabilities over time, thereby realizing the long-term savings of permeable driveways through sustainable water management.
Regular Cleaning and Maintenance Routines

Regular cleaning and maintenance routines are essential for keeping permeable walking paths in optimal condition. This eco-friendly paving material, designed to allow water filtration and reduce stormwater runoff, requires a different approach compared to traditional non-permeable surfaces. Unlike solid materials that repel water, permeable paving allows rain and melting snow to pass through, recharging groundwater and minimizing flooding risks. However, this unique property also means it can accumulate debris more readily, affecting its effectiveness.
To ensure the longevity and functionality of your permeable path, establish a consistent maintenance schedule. This includes regular sweeping or brushing to remove surface debris like leaves, twigs, and gravel, as well as occasional deep cleaning with appropriate cleaners designed for permeable surfaces. Additionally, monitoring and repairing any damaged or missing pavers is crucial. Inspect for Cracks and Damage Regularly

Regular inspections are key to maintaining the integrity of permeable walking paths. Cracks and damage can go unnoticed, especially in heavily trafficked areas or regions with extreme weather conditions. Therefore, it’s crucial to establish a routine checking process. Look for any signs of heaving, sinking, or shifting in the pavers, as these could indicate structural issues. Also, inspect for cracks that might have formed due to settling or movement of the underlying soil. These regular checks will help identify problems early on, preventing more severe damage and ensuring the effectiveness of your permeable paving system, thereby promoting backyard water conservation with permeable paving and contributing to urban planning’s green infrastructure using permeable pavements.
During these inspections, pay special attention to areas exposed to heavy loads or significant changes in temperature. Such environments can accelerate wear and tear, making them more prone to damage.
